Mastering Laravel 13 from Scratch: A Practical Guide to Building Real Projects, Understanding Modern Laravel, and Becoming a Confident Backend Developer - Tapa blanda

Hayes, Roman

 
9798199664356: Mastering Laravel 13 from Scratch: A Practical Guide to Building Real Projects, Understanding Modern Laravel, and Becoming a Confident Backend Developer

Sinopsis


A Practical Guide to Building Real Projects, Understanding Modern Laravel, and Becoming a Confident Backend Developer

Stop Watching Tutorials. Start Building Real Laravel Applications.

Have you spent countless hours watching Laravel videos, reading blog posts, and following coding tutorials—only to find yourself stuck when it's time to build a project on your own?

You're not alone.

Many aspiring developers learn Laravel in fragments. They understand individual concepts but struggle to connect everything into a complete, working application. As a result, they lack the confidence needed to build professional projects, pursue freelance opportunities, or apply for backend development roles.

Mastering Laravel 13 from Scratch was written to solve that problem.

Instead of overwhelming you with theory, this hands-on guide takes a practical, project-based approach that teaches Laravel the way professional developers actually use it. You'll learn by building, implementing, testing, and improving real-world applications while mastering the core concepts that power modern web development.

Whether you're a complete beginner, a PHP developer transitioning to Laravel, or a self-taught programmer looking to level up your skills, this book provides a clear roadmap from fundamentals to professional development practices.

Inside This Book, You'll Learn How To:

Install and configure Laravel 13 like a professional developer

Understand MVC architecture and Laravel's application structure

Build dynamic web applications using routes, controllers, and Blade templates

Design and manage databases using migrations, seeders, and factories

Master Eloquent ORM and create powerful database relationships

Validate forms and process user input securely

Implement authentication, authorization, and role-based access control

Build professional RESTful APIs with Laravel Sanctum

Handle file uploads, media management, and cloud storage workflows

Use queues, events, jobs, notifications, and task scheduling

Write automated tests and debug applications efficiently

Optimize Laravel applications for performance and scalability

Deploy projects to production environments with confidence

Follow modern Laravel development standards and best practices

Build a Real Project as You Learn

This isn't a book filled with disconnected code snippets.

Throughout the book, you'll progressively build and enhance a complete Laravel application that incorporates the same features found in professional web systems, including:

  • User authentication
  • Dashboard functionality
  • CRUD operations
  • Database relationships
  • Role management
  • REST APIs
  • File uploads
  • Notifications
  • Security controls
  • Deployment preparation

By the end of the book, you'll have a portfolio-worthy project that demonstrates practical Laravel skills employers and clients value.

Why This Book Is Different

Many Laravel books teach features.

This book teaches development.

You'll not only learn what Laravel can do—you'll understand why specific tools, patterns, and architectures are used in real-world projects. Every chapter includes practical examples, code walkthroughs, best practices, common mistakes to avoid, and implementation strategies used by professional developers.

Who This Book Is For
  • Complete beginners learning Laravel
  • PHP developers moving into modern frameworks
  • Computer science students
  • Self-taught programmers
  • Freelance web developers
  • Junior developers seeking backend positions
  • Anyone who wants to build real Laravel applications with confidence

"Sinopsis" puede pertenecer a otra edición de este libro.